I was trying to search for a word containing an umlaut, but I wasn't
able to ender it after pressing /. After that I tried with other
non-ascii characters and mupdf seems to ignore all of them.

Incomplete patch for mupdf-x11 1.15 attached (works with utf-8 locales; there are display problems in some non-utf-8 locales - it is possible to input [ascii and non-ascii] symbols, but search string and prompt is invisible); XKB (tested with cyrillic keyboard layout) and IM input seems works (tested with LANG=ja_JP.UTF-8 and uim/anthy).
